虚拟主机与SSL证书,打造安全网络环境的关键步骤
虚拟主机和SSL证书是构建安全、可靠网络环境的关键组件,虚拟主机提供了服务器托管服务,而SSL证书则用于加密数据传输,确保信息的安全性,两者结合使用,可以有效防止数据泄露和恶意攻击,保护用户的隐私和信息安全。
在互联网世界中,数据的安全传输是保障用户隐私和企业信息安全的关键,为了确保用户的在线交易、通信等关键业务得到充分保护,许多网站和服务提供商都采用了SSL(Secure Sockets Layer)证书技术来增强其安全性。
虚拟主机如何通过使用SSL证书来提升其服务的安全性?
什么是SSL证书?
- SSL证书是一种数字证书,用于加密和验证网络连接中的数据安全,它通过提供身份认证和数据完整性检查功能,确保只有授权的实体才能访问受保护的数据,并且这些数据没有被篡改。
- 常见的SSL证书类型包括:单域名证书、多域证书以及服务器证书等。
如何为虚拟主机添加SSL证书?
-
选择合适的SSL证书:
- 小型站点或个人博客可以选择购买便宜但功能强大的通用型SSL证书。
- 针对大型企业网站,可能需要更高级别的证书以满足严格的业务需求。
-
安装SSL证书:
- 根据所选的SSL证书类型,从发行商官网下载并安装相应的证书文件到服务器上,通常需要手动复制证书文件到特定目录下,
/etc/letsencrypt/live/yourdomain.com/
。
- 根据所选的SSL证书类型,从发行商官网下载并安装相应的证书文件到服务器上,通常需要手动复制证书文件到特定目录下,
-
配置Apache/Nginx等Web服务器:
- 如果使用的是Apache Web服务器,在配置文件中添加相关指令:
SSLCertificateFile /path/to/your/certificate.crt SSLCertificateKeyFile /path/to/private/key.key
- 同样地,对于Nginx,需要在配置文件中添加类似设置:
ssl_certificate /path/to/your/certificate.crt; ssl_certificate_key /path/to/private/key.key;
- 如果使用的是Apache Web服务器,在配置文件中添加相关指令:
-
重启Web服务器:
- 安装完成后,务必重启Web服务器以使更改生效,这可以通过命令行实现,如:
sudo systemctl restart apache2 # 对于Apache sudo systemctl restart nginx # 对于Nginx
- 安装完成后,务必重启Web服务器以使更改生效,这可以通过命令行实现,如:
-
测试SSL证书的有效性和功能:
- 在浏览器地址栏输入你的域名后加上
https://
(注意区分大小写),尝试访问你的网站,如果一切正常,你应该能看到一个绿色的锁图标表示SSL证书有效,并且数据传输应该是加密的。
- 在浏览器地址栏输入你的域名后加上
通过正确安装和配置SSL证书,虚拟主机不仅可以提高网站的安全性,还可以显著增加客户信任度和用户体验,随着网络安全意识的不断提高,拥有SSL证书已经成为了大多数现代网站的基本要求之一,无论是小型个人博客主还是大型企业网站管理员,都应该考虑为其网站添加SSL证书,从而更好地保护你的在线资产。
扫描二维码推送至手机访问。
声明:本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。